Output 3df0d56bb39831e783f133e74194c7f5a4c8cfa27d84185d24c3f73054d5b38c:0

value
25938041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a3d1329cb951f2080e8c9619ea99a601061976 OP_EQUAL
address
38x7Yv3sreLsmczNxa27NiYtProxpZSbJb
transaction
3df0d56bb39831e783f133e74194c7f5a4c8cfa27d84185d24c3f73054d5b38c
spent
true